About Connemara Chamber of Commerce Established to promote sustainable economic development for the benefit of the people of Clifden and the wider Connemara region, Connemara Chamber of Commerce plays a central role in representing local business interests, supporting tourism and advancing community-led initiatives. The Chamber acts as a critical link between business, government and community stakeholders, advocating for infrastructure investment, promoting regional tourism and co-ordinating major local events that enhance the areas vitality and economic resilience.
